Alı Başçı is a scholar working on Nephrology,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Alı Başçı has authored 61 papers receiving a total of 3.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 33 papers in Nephrology, 14 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and 9 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Alı Başçı's work include Dialysis and Renal Disease Management (25 papers), Blood Pressure and Hypertension Studies (8 papers) and Central Venous Catheters and Hemodialysis (6 papers). Alı Başçı is often cited by papers focused on Dialysis and Renal Disease Management (25 papers), Blood Pressure and Hypertension Studies (8 papers) and Central Venous Catheters and Hemodialysis (6 papers). Alı Başçı coll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ye, Germany and United States. Alı Başçı's co-authors include Mehmet Özkahya, Hüseyin Töz, Soner Duman, Jeroen P. Kooman, James Tattersall, Alejandro Martín‐Malo, Denis Fouque, Patrick Haage, Jan Tordoir and Marianne Vennegoor and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Investigation, Kidney International and Journal of the American Society of Nephrology.
